Speaker:
DuyHai Doan
Bio:
DuyHai DOAN is an Apache Cassandra Evangelist at DataStax. He spends his time between technical presentations/meetups on Cassandra, coding on open source projects like Achilles or Apache Zeppelin to support the community and helping all companies using Cassandra to make their project successful. Previously he was working as a freelance Java/Cassandra consultant.
Title:
User Defined Functions and Materialized Views in Cassandra 3.0
Abstract:
Cassandra is evolving at a very fast pace and keeps introducing new features that close the gap with traditional SQL world, but they are always designed with a distributed approach in mind. First we'll throw an eye at the recent user-defined functions and show how they can improve your application performance and enrich your analytics use-cases. Next, a tour on the materialized views, a major improvement that drastically changes the way people model data in Cassandra and makes developers' life easier!
